We would like to take a moment to celebrate a truly inspiring achievement by a group of our Citizens UK students, who attended the recent delegate assembly on Tuesday 5 May 2026 to speak on issues affecting our community.
Representing the school with exceptional maturity, courage, and passion, several of students delivered a powerful and thought-provoking speech focusing on students’ experiences of racism on public transport. A year 9 student also shared a personal experience with remarkable honesty and bravery, leaving a lasting impression on everyone in attendance.
Cruz (Year 10) continued his ongoing advocacy work around improving temporary accommodation across Liverpool, contributing thoughtful ideas and speaking with purpose and conviction.
All of the students demonstrated outstanding confidence as they addressed an audience of over 120 people from a wide range of ages and backgrounds. Their willingness to stand up, speak out, and use their voices to push for positive change was truly commendable.
We are incredibly proud of their efforts and the example they have set as young leaders working to make a difference in our community.
